WebbParkinson’s Law states that work expands to fill the time available for its completion. Essentially, this law means that no matter how much time you’ve allocated for your work, … Parkinson's law is the observation that public administration, bureaucracy and officialdom expands, regardless of the amount of work to be done. This was attributed mainly to two factors: that officials want subordinates, not rivals, and that officials make work for each other.
